In the year-to-date period, BHBFX achieves a 8.61% return, which is significantly lower than TORYX's 10.28% return. Both investments have delivered pretty close results over the past 10 years, with BHBFX having a 9.97% annualized return and TORYX not far behind at 9.76%.

The correlation between BHBFX and TORYX is 0.76,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

The maximum BHBFX drawdown since its inception was -34.07%, smaller than the maximum TORYX drawdown of -56.55%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for BHBFX and TORYX.

The current volatility for Madison Dividend Income Fund (BHBFX) is 3.04%, while Torray Fund (TORYX) has a volatility of 3.75%. This indicates that BHBFX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than TORYX based on this measure.
